Plain-English summary
Stalkers Act of 2011 - Amends the federal criminal code to revise stalking provisions to prohibit: (1) the use of any electronic communication service or electronic communication system of interstate commerce to stalk victims; and (2) conduct that attempts to, or that would be reasonably expected to, cause substantial emotional distress to such a victim.
